Output 68c33fd129d4c031da90e2076c4cf924e33b513e839fec09809906fbe864b377:32

value
3717067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0aa6c7304f1a78207aa4c6ed05bae99e4087cc4 OP_EQUAL
address
3Ho91YhRM6Z2P4wKfLDH4P4o3FPHB2ydhD
transaction
68c33fd129d4c031da90e2076c4cf924e33b513e839fec09809906fbe864b377
confirmations
126476
spent
true